Sharing the same sun: How pandemic trends reshaped sun care via TKS

Consumer lifestyles and priorities shifted because of the pandemic. The behavioral and structural changes caused new trends, which include appreciating time outside. Sun care companies have an opportunity to listen and respond to the changing perceptions of consumers by fitting sunscreen into these highlighted considerations. Further, the new priorities of consumers present several areas of growth and innovation.

By acknowledging and addressing the evolving social climate, specifically towards inclusivity and sustainability, companies can demonstrate industry awareness of market trends and, ultimately, create an advantageous product to better connect with the consumer.
